Moving into their new home, the murder mystery writer and his wife find themselves with a corpse on their back lawn and a building full of suspects. A very appealing performance from the now-forgotten Aherne and a solid cast of character actors add up to lively fun. (By the way, Paramount Home Video offers an excellent British Filra with the same name about the sinking of the Titanic.)
